(Undated) – Several student-athletes who play in the Ohio River Valley Conference have been recognized for their early season performances in various fall sports. 

The ORVC report for August 9-21 and August 23-29 were released on Tuesday.

Rising Sun’s Kendall Montgomery was the top performer in boys soccer between August 9-21. The Shiners star recorded five goals and two assists over two matches.

The top girls soccer player to start the month was Switzerland County’s Raylinn Kappes. She scored five goals and assisted on two others in three matches.

South Ripley’s Lanie Nicholson and Luke Bradley started the cross country season with strong performances at Southwestern Shelbyville. Nicholson finished with a time of 21:00, while Bradley crossed the finish line with a time of 21:02.

The ORVC Volleyball Player of the Week for August 23-29 went to Jac-Cen-Del’s Aundrea Cullen. In two matches, Cullen accumulated 37 digs, 11 kill attempts, 5 aces, and 2 kills. She also completed 90 percent of her passes and put 89 percent of her serves in play.

Lanie Nicholson repeated as the ORVC Girls Runner of the Week with at time of 20:16 at South Decatur and 20:17 at Rushville.

The ORVC Boys Runner of the Week for August 23-29 went to Jac-Cen-Del’s Josh Pohle. The Eagles star ran a 17:38 at South Decatur and a 17:59 at Rushville.

Milan’s Kayla Walke is the latest ORVC Girls Golfer of the Week. Walke shot 47 at St. Anne’s, 48 at Belterra, and 58 at Hidden Acres.

In boys soccer, Switzerland County’s Cooper Todd is the Player of the Week. Todd totaled four goals and two assists in three matches.

The ORVC Girls Soccer Player of the Week went to Milan’s Alyssa Phelps. She scored two goals and assisted on two others over a two match span.
